2. Single main rotor Use a main rotor to generate lift Tail rotor balances main rotor’s torque
3. Coaxial Two rotors spinning in opposite directions Compensate each other’s torque No need for tail rotor Aerodynamic symmetry Stable Easier to fly More compact
